Mr Tedros welcomed developments from the central Chinese city of Wuhan, where the outbreak originated, which reported no new cases on Thursday. Studies have show that people of all ages can be infected by the virus - but it is especially dangerous for older people and those with underlying illnesses.Fewer than 1% of patients under the age of 50 died in China, according to the New York Times. But it was fatal for nearly 15% of those who were over the age of 80.
